Loft Conversion | Kingsdown, Deal

Project Description: Loft conversion in Kingsdown, Deal, Kent

Total Gross Internal Area: Proposed 122.24m²

Planning Granted: Full Planning Permission obtained and Building Control sign-off.

Procurement Method: Fully managed by client by appointing individual subcontractors and purchasing high value materials direct from suppliers.

Construction Technique: Traditional conversion techniques insulating between and over roof timbers.

Blackrock Architecture Appointment: This loft conversion was delivered as a later phase to a recently completed new build property. From the outset, the intention was to fully maximise the available roof volume and create a substantial additional storey that matched the quality and ambition of the original house.

The project benefited from an unusually hands-on delivery approach, with the client taking on full management of the works. As an exceptionally skilled tradesman with meticulous attention to detail, the client led the construction process, appointing specialist subcontractors directly and sourcing premium materials from trusted suppliers.

Maximising space within the roof volume

The scale of the roof space allowed for a highly generous internal layout, transforming the loft into a fully functional upper floor rather than a secondary or ancillary space.

The loft conversion provides:

  • Four spacious double bedrooms
  • Two well-appointed en-suite bathrooms
  • A separate family bathroom
  • A large and comfortable landing space

The layout was carefully planned to ensure excellent circulation, privacy between bedrooms and a sense of openness throughout the floor.

Statement vaulted ceilings and stair core

One of the defining features of this loft conversion is the dramatic use of vaulted ceilings combined with extensive roof glazing. These elements flood the space with natural light and create a striking architectural statement at the heart of the home.

The landing and stair core were treated as key design moments rather than purely functional spaces. The combination of height, structure and glazing delivers a strong sense of arrival and visual connection between levels.
